Twenty people from all walks of life, all strangers to each other, wake up in an isolated island resort with no memory of how they arrived. Each of them has a document, signed in their own handwriting:
    1. I am player in the Game.
    2. The players must participate in the Game.
    3. The players may agree to change the rules.
    4. The players must obey the rules or forfeit.
    5. The winner of the Game is the last player who has not forfeited.

They have no explanation, and no communication with the outside world. And, shortly after one of their number refuses to acknowledge the “game,” they all discover what it means to forfeit…

As more people die, and strange lights are seen inland, the survivors must struggle with the game and each other to discover why they’ve been placed here, and who is executing the losers.
